Why is your soft play for indoor use only?

Keeping soft play indoors protects the padded equipment from mud, damp ground and changing weather, while also helping us maintain the cleaning standards expected for equipment used by toddlers.

For outdoor events in Bath, a suitable bouncy castle may be a better option during the outdoor hire season, while the soft play remains inside the venue.

What should I check with my Bath venue before booking?

Three practical details are worth confirming early: the amount of usable floor space, access to the room and the time the venue allows suppliers to enter for setup.

If your booking also includes a bouncy castle, ceiling height becomes important too. Some venues have plenty of floor space but lower roof sections, beams or lighting that limit which inflatables can be installed.
